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Gansu Shrew | Pyralid moth |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Arthropoda (Arthropods)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Insecta (Insects) |
| Order | Soricomorpha (Soricomorpha) | Lepidoptera (Butterflies & Moths) |
| Family | Soricidae | Pyralidae |
| Genus | Sorex | Acrobasis |
| Species | Sorex cansulus | Acrobasis suavella |
